![]() In 2006, the name was formally changed to “Windows PowerShell” which bid goodbye to the old-school batch file scripting.Ĭommand Prompt or cmd is the command line interpreter for Microsoft Windows operating systems used to automate various system related tasks using scripts and batch files. By 2005, Microsoft already released three versions of Monad. It managed to get over the shortcomings of its predecessor. So, Microsoft started working on a new approach to command line management and finally released a new improved CLI called “Monad” in 2002. It wasn’t powerful enough to satisfy power users. However, the command line interpreter was not able to provide consistency because they could not be used to automate multifaceted functionalities of the graphical user interface. BAT file to be run in the MS-DOS prompt, this enhanced 32-bit command line interpreter made the batch language more useful owing to the many enhancements and additional features. On contrast to the earlier versions which would only allow a. Microsoft included a command line interpreter called “Command Prompt” (or “cmd”) in its Windows NT line of operating systems which used basically the same commands of the but with additional features. ![]() Then comes Windows which quickly evolved from an application to a full-fledge operating system. Microsoft released several versions of DOS over time subsequently extending the batch files in many ways. Microsoft made it run on IBM PCs acting both as kernel and shell along with some additional features of other shells. It was basically a clone of Digital Research’s CP/M, one of the very first operating systems for microcomputer. Batch file scripting goes all the way back to the time when MS-DOS was released in 1981 as an operating system for IBM personal computers.
